This is part of the Maxwell Cup (Top Collegiate teams play across the street including National Champs University of Oklahoma in 2017 and Oklahoma State University 2018 National Champs)….but before they play the University of Oklahoma helped us promote golf for kids by giving individual lessons, hand out free clubs and talk about golf in general. I talked to several kids about golf management and working on the golf course in the summer. This was at Lake View Golf Club in Ardmore, where I went for two years to help get the club back into a positive program for the City. We had over 200 children show up each year for the event in the small town of 28,000.

Joseph Hubbard, CGCS/CEMP, Certified Golf Course Superintendent at the Boca Delray Golf & Country Club, is a huge supporter of First Green, the innovative education outreach program using golf courses as hands-on environmental learning labs. First Green has worked with golf course superintendents extensively for more than 20 years. The First Green Foundation (First Green) and Golf Course Superintendents Association of America (GCSAA) recently brought First Green under the umbrella of the GCSAA’s philanthropic organization, the Environmental Institute for Golf (EIFG).
